"""
什么是模块
模块:就是一系列功能的结合体
模块的三种来源:
1.内置的(就是python解释器自带的)
2.第三方的(别人写的)
3.自定义的(你自己写的)
模块的四种表现形式
1.使用python编辑的朋友文件(就是意味着py文件也可以称之为莫苦熬:一个py文件就是一个模块
2.即被便衣为共享库或者DLL的c或者c++货站的(了解)
3.把一系列模块组织到一个文件的(文件夹下面有一个__init__.py文件该文件称之为包
4.使用c编写 病链接到python解释器的内置模块
为什么要用模块
1.用被人写好的模块(内置的 或者第三方的):典型就是拿来主义 主要是为了提高开发效率 这也是python的特点
2.使用自己写的模块(自定义的):当程序比较庞大的时候,你的项目不可能只有一个py文件
那么当多个文件中都要使用相同方法的时候就可以将该文件放在公共区域 在其他模块箱用的是时候
直接调过去用就了
*********在使用模块的时候 注意 一定要曲风那个是执行文件,哪个是被导入文件!!!!!!!